During the incident, the Quellhorn deduplicator collapsed distinct paging alerts from the Fennick ingest tier into a single notification, delaying triage by roughly 20 minutes. The dedup window is currently set to 15 minutes globally, which is too aggressive for multi-service incidents. The on-call engineer should lower the window for the ingest alert group to 3 minutes and verify behavior in the staging pager. Full tuning guidance and rollback steps are documented on the internal page here.

wiki page, tahaf-tajog: https://jira.ordindyn.corp/pipeline

Q2 Planning Note — Sales Leads

Ventara is in early discussions to acquire Loomfield Analytics, a smaller competitor in the mid-market forecasting space. Nothing is signed; diligence is ongoing through next quarter. Until further notice, continue selling against Loomfield as usual and do not reference the talks with prospects. Pipeline targets are unchanged. Deal terms and integration plans are summarized in the confidential note below.

board note of kageg-bahof: The renewal with Holwynax Holdings closes at $2 million a year, 5 percent below the last contract. Project Ulaath slips by two quarters because of the supplier delay.

Flagwright reads all rollout settings from environment variables at process start; nothing is fetched from disk afterward, which keeps the audit surface small. `FLAGWRIGHT_COHORT_SEED` must differ between staging and production so percentage rollouts don't correlate across environments. `FLAGWRIGHT_SYNC_INTERVAL` controls how often the Dunmore control plane is polled; values below 5s are rejected. All control-plane calls are authenticated, and the reviewer should verify rotation policy for the credential defined on the following line.

vault entry, yahif-yajep: COURIER_KEY29=b802bdf8034096b65a51c6ba5abe2